목차

캐시 관리(템플릿)

1. 개요

캐시관리는 전자정부표준프레임워크 실행환경에서 제공하는 캐시 서비스를 실제 소스 레벨에서 사용하기 위한 가이드를 소스 템플릿으로 제공하여 캐시 서비스를 쉽게 이용할 수 있게 도와준다.

캐시 서비스에 대한 자세한 내용은 https://www.egovframe.go.kr/wiki/doku.php?id=egovframework:rte:fdl:cache 참고한다.

캐시관리(템플릿)

캐시에 대한 등록,수정,삭제,리로딩에 대한 기능을 구현할 수 있는 소스 템플릿을 미리보기로 제공한다.

캐시 등록

설정관리 도구 메인화면 » 좌측 메뉴 » 캐시관리(템플릿) » 캐시등록

아래와 같이 캐시 등록을 위한 값을 입력 받는다.

  1. Element 추가: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 추가할 경우 사용
  2. Element 삭제: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 삭제할 경우 사용
  3. 코드템플릿 생성: 입력 받은 데이터를 이용하여 캐시 등록 코드 템플릿 생성

아래와 같이 캐시 등록을 위한 템플릿을 생성한다.

캐시 삭제

설정관리 도구 메인화면 » 좌측 메뉴 » 캐시관리(템플릿) » 캐시삭제

아래와 같이 캐시 삭제를 위한 값을 입력 받는다.

  1. Element 추가: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 추가할 경우 사용
  2. Element 삭제: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 삭제할 경우 사용
  3. 코드템플릿 생성: 입력 받은 데이터를 이용하여 캐시 등록 코드 템플릿 생성

아래와 같이 캐시 삭제를 위한 템플릿을 생성한다.

캐시 조회

설정관리 도구 메인화면 » 좌측 메뉴 » 캐시관리(템플릿) » 캐시조회

아래와 같이 캐시 조회를 위한 값을 입력 받는다.

{{:egovframework:oe1:설정관리:가이드:캐시등록.jpg|}}

  1. Element 추가: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 추가할 경우 사용
  2. Element 삭제: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 삭제할 경우 사용
  3. 코드템플릿 생성: 입력 받은 데이터를 이용하여 캐시 등록 코드 템플릿 생성

아래와 같이 캐시 삭제을 위한 템플릿을 생성한다.

캐시 리로딩

설정관리 도구 메인화면 » 좌측 메뉴 » 캐시관리(템플릿) » 캐시리로딩

아래와 같이 캐시 리로딩을 위한 값을 입력 받는다.

{{:egovframework:oe1:설정관리:가이드:캐시등록.jpg|}}

  1. Element 추가: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 추가할 경우 사용
  2. Element 삭제: 캐시안에 Key, Value 쌍으로 들어가있는 Element 를 삭제할 경우 사용
  3. 코드템플릿 생성: 입력 받은 데이터를 이용하여 캐시 등록 코드 템플릿 생성

아래와 같이 캐시 리로딩를 위한 템플릿을 생성한다.